Ingredients
For the Meatballs
- 24 frozen cooked meatballs (about 1.5 pounds)
For the Sauce
- 18 ounces BBQ sauce
For the Eyeballs
- 4 ounces fresh mozzarella cheese, sliced into 24 thin rounds
- 1 (3.8-ounce) can sliced black olives, drained
For Assembly
- 24 wooden toothpicks

How to Make Halloween Eyeball Meatballs
Step 1: Combine Meatballs and Sauce
In a large saucepan, combine the frozen cooked meatballs and BBQ sauce.
Step 2: Heat the Mixture
Heat the meatballs and sauce over medium-low heat for about 15-20 minutes. Stir occasionally until the meatballs are thoroughly heated through.
Step 3: Prepare the Eyeballs
While the meatballs are heating, prepare the eyeballs. Separate the pre-sliced black olives.
Step 4: Transfer Meatballs
Once heated, carefully transfer the meatballs to a serving platter. Make sure each meatball is well-coated in sauce.
Step 5: Add Cheese
Place one round slice of fresh mozzarella cheese on top of each warm meatball. The heat will slightly soften the cheese.
Step 6: Create Eyeballs
Place one black olive slice in the center of each mozzarella round, creating the pupil of the eyeball.
Step 7: Secure with Toothpicks
Insert a wooden toothpick through the olive, mozzarella, and into each meatball to secure the eyeball in place.
Step 8: Serve Immediately
Enjoy your spooky appetizer right away while warm for maximum flavor!

Refrigerator Storage
- Store leftover Halloween Eyeball Meatballs in an airtight container.
- They can be kept in the fridge for up to 3 days.
Freezing Halloween Eyeball Meatballs
- Place cooled meatballs in a freezer-safe container or bag.
- They can be frozen for up to 3 months.
Reheating Halloween Eyeball Meatballs
- Oven – Preheat to 350°F (175°C) and bake for about 15-20 minutes until heated through.
- Microwave – Heat on high for 1-2 minutes, checking every 30 seconds to avoid overheating.
- Stovetop – Warm in a skillet over medium heat, stirring gently until heated through.
